Output 66520e56c2ecd0859217576681a116420ee4941a4edb718307a920bb8262dc2b:940

value
1325
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 837b3dbe0c099631722d69ae417b7f6453615aacb10b68721de0490354096967
address
bc1psdanm0svpxtrzu3ddxhyz7mlv3fkzk4vky9ksusaupysx4qfd9nscxcd2y
transaction
66520e56c2ecd0859217576681a116420ee4941a4edb718307a920bb8262dc2b